The Repair Shop: Episode 46 (S2022EP46 BBC One Thursday 3 November 2022)
Three family heirlooms are revived by Jay Blades and the team, bringing back the memories they contain.
Clint Yallop is the first person to enter the barn. He brought in his grandfather’s notebook, which urgently needs Chris Shaw’s bookbinding expertise. George Yallop, Clint’s grandfather, meticulously recorded his research and experiments in notebooks like this while working as a pathology technician at the Royal London Hospital in the early 1900s. This one is unfortunately the last, which makes it even more special to Clint. He recalls his grandfather as a fascinating man who was always friendly and hospitable. Clint wants to use the scientific notebook for his own horticulture studies, but the thin book is falling apart. Chris is enthralled by the tiny notebook and plunges headfirst into the unusual restoration task.
Matt Goddard is the next person to arrive at the barn, and he is hoping that woodsman Will Kirk can finish a labour of love that is unfinished. Although Matt has good intentions, he is aware that the intricate construction is beyond him because his father passed away before he could complete this model of a merchant trading ship. It has been decades since the nautical build was abandoned, but Matt and his siblings believe that now is the right time to complete what their father began and pass it down to the next generation so that they can all be reminded of his love of all things nautical. Will focuses on the complex wooden structure while Amanda uses ropes to assist with the sails.
Sarah Kershaw, the barn’s final guest for the day, is greeted by goldsmith Richard Talman. Sarah brought Brenda’s tiny silver locket into the room. Her husband, Sarah’s father, gave it to her as an engagement gift in the 1960s, but it has since broken and become unwearable. It did contain some adorable images of the couple, but one of them—along with the heart-shaped frame that kept it in place—is now missing. A few years ago, they lost Sarah’s father, and Sarah is aware that her mother would dearly love to wear the locket once more as a constant reminder of her devoted husband. Richard gets to work repairing the severe tarnishing and creating new parts so Brenda can use it once more.

The Repair Shop is a workshop of dreams, where broken or damaged cherished family heirlooms are brought back to life.
Furniture restorers, horologists, metal workers, ceramicists, upholsterers and all manner of skilled craftsmen and women have been brought together to work in one extraordinary space, restoring much-loved possessions to their former glory.
Many of these items have incredible stories behind them and a unique place in history: from an accordion played in the Blitz by a woman who is now in her 90s, to a beautifully crafted clock made by a father who was completely blind; a Pinball machine that is currently being used as a kitchen counter, and a Davenport desk with its trademark fake drawers which fooled burglars – and their crowbar.
The Repair Shop is an antidote to our throwaway culture and shines a light on the wonderful treasures to be found in homes across the country.
